Your windows’ function is to allow air and light into your home, but how well they do their job depends on their style and design. That’s why it’s important to pick the style that best suits your needs when planning a window replacement.

- Casement windows. Casement windows are hinged on the side and swing outward. This design allows you to enjoy a good amount of fresh air. When casements are closed, they create an airtight seal that prevents heated and conditioned air from escaping your home. This is crucial to your HVAC system, as it promotes the efficient operation of your heating and cooling equipment — meaning your heater or air conditioner won’t have to work as hard to maintain the desired temperature.
- Picture windows. Picture windows are designed for those who want to be able to fully enjoy their outdoor view. Your window and roofing contractor will tell you that these windows can also grant you a stunning curbside view and access to natural light. Unfortunately, picture windows are fixed, so they can’t contribute to ventilation. To ensure your home’s ventilation doesn’t suffer, you can install a combination of picture and operable windows. Picture windows are easy to maintain since they don’t have numerous moving parts, so they can still prove to be a great addition to your home.
- Awning windows. Awning windows closely resemble casement windows, except for the fact that they’re hinged at the top. These windows are known for their ease of maintenance and superior natural ventilation. They’re also versatile since they can be installed in any room.
